Expansion of Radiance Glow Skincare in North America

As Radiance Glow Skincare (RGS) continues to expand in Australia, the company is exploring opportunities to enter the North American skincare market. This study evaluates the feasibility of this expansion by examining market trends, consumer preferences, competitive conditions, and strategic challenges. The analysis indicates that increasing consumer demand for skincare products with health-promoting ingredients creates favorable market opportunities for RGS. However, the company's medium-sized scale, limited brand recognition, and lack of experience in the North American market represent significant barriers to successful entry. The findings suggest that market expansion is feasible if supported by a well-defined market entry strategy, effective risk management, product localization, and strategic partnerships. This study provides practical insights for firms seeking international expansion in the rapidly evolving skincare industry.
